🥑 Ingredients Needed
To successfully learn how to make Zucchini Chicken Enchiladas, gather these fresh ingredients:
- Zucchini
Large zucchini are sliced thinly lengthwise to replace tortillas. - Cooked Shredded Chicken
Rotisserie chicken works perfectly and saves time. - Enchilada Sauce
Adds the classic smoky, spicy enchilada flavour. - Shredded Cheese
Cheddar, Monterey Jack, or Mexican blend melt beautifully. - Garlic
Enhances the overall savoury flavour. - Onion
Adds sweetness and depth to the filling. - Olive Oil
Used for sautéing the filling ingredients. - Cumin
A signature Mexican spice that adds warmth. - Chili Powder
Provides mild heat and authentic enchilada taste. - Salt & Black Pepper
Balances the flavours. - Fresh Cilantro (Optional)
Adds freshness and colour. - Greek Yogurt Or Sour Cream (Optional)
For a creamy topping when serving.

👩🍳 Step-By-Step Guide To Cooking
🌮 How To Make Zucchini Chicken Enchiladas
Follow this detailed guide to perfectly master How To Make Zucchini Chicken Enchiladas.
Step 1: Prepare The Zucchini Strips
- Wash the zucchini thoroughly.
- Slice them lengthwise into thin strips using a mandoline or sharp knife.
- Lay slices on paper towels.
- Sprinkle lightly with salt to remove excess moisture.
Step 2: Cook The Chicken Filling
- Heat olive oil in a skillet over medium heat.
- Add chopped onions and sauté until soft.
- Stir in garlic and cook for about 30 seconds.
- Add shredded chicken.
- Mix in cumin, chilli powder, salt, and pepper.
- Pour in a small amount of enchilada sauce.
- Stir until well combined.
This flavorful mixture is essential when making Zucchini Chicken Enchiladas.
Step 3: Assemble The Enchilada Roll-Ups
- Preheat oven to 375°F (190°C).
- Spread a thin layer of enchilada sauce in a baking dish.
- Lay 2–3 zucchini strips slightly overlapping.
- Add a spoonful of chicken filling.
- Sprinkle cheese.
- Roll tightly like a tortilla enchilada.
Repeat until all ingredients are used.
Step 4: Add Sauce And Cheese
- Arrange roll-ups in the baking dish.
- Pour the remaining enchilada sauce over them.
- Sprinkle shredded cheese generously on top.
This step enhances the flavour when making Zucchini Chicken Enchiladas.
Step 5: Bake The Enchiladas
- Cover the dish lightly with foil.
- Bake for 20 minutes.
- Remove foil and bake another 10 minutes until cheese is bubbly.
Step 6: Garnish And Serve
- Remove from oven.
- Sprinkle chopped cilantro.
- Add sour cream or yoghurt if desired.
Your Zucchini Chicken Enchiladas are now ready to enjoy!

🔥 Tips For Perfect Results
Mastering Zucchini Chicken Enchiladas becomes easier with these expert tips:
- Use Large Zucchini
Larger zucchini produce longer slices for easy rolling. - Remove Moisture
Salting zucchini prevents watery enchiladas. - Slice Thinly
Thin slices roll better and cook evenly. - Don’t Overfill Rolls
Too much filling makes rolling difficult. - Use Quality Enchilada Sauce
A good sauce defines the flavour profile. - Add Extra Cheese Between Layers
This enhances richness and texture. - Bake Until Bubbly
The sauce should slightly caramelise.

🌶️ Variations
There are many ways to customise Zucchini Chicken Enchiladas.
- 🧀 Cheesy Enchiladas
- Add cream cheese or extra mozzarella for a richer texture.
- 🌱 Vegetarian Version
- Replace chicken with black beans or sautéed mushrooms.
- 🔥 Spicy Enchiladas
- Add jalapeños or hot sauce for extra heat.
- 🥑 Keto Version
- Use full-fat cheese and homemade enchilada sauce.
- 🌮 Beef Enchiladas
- Swap chicken with seasoned ground beef.

❓ Frequently Asked Questions
Q1. Can I Make Zucchini Chicken Enchiladas Ahead Of Time?
👉 Yes. Assemble the enchiladas and refrigerate for up to 24 hours before baking.
Q2. Why Are My Zucchini Enchiladas Watery?
👉 Zucchini releases water naturally. Salting the slices beforehand removes excess moisture.
Q3. Can I Freeze Zucchini Chicken Enchiladas?
the 👉 Yes, but for the best texture, freeze before baking. Thaw overnight before cooking.
Q4. What Sauce Works Best For This Recipe?
👉 Traditional red enchilada sauce works best, but green enchilada sauce also tastes great.
Q5. Can I Use Turkey Instead Of Chicken?
👉 Absolutely. Shredded turkey is a great substitute and works perfectly in this recipe.
